Job Description

Bus Driver

Training Rate:$20.47 per Hour

Contracted Rate:$25.71 per Hour

Sub Driver Rate:$21.49 per Hour

JOB DESCRIPTION

Findpurpose flexible hours and a strong sense of community as a school bus driver!As a school bus driver you play a crucial role in ensuring students have a safe reliable ride to and from school. You become a trusted presence in their daily lives setting the tone for a great start and end to their bus drivers enjoy perks such as flexible schedules health and retirement benefits and paid holidays. Enjoy a schedule during school hours with opportunities to earn through field trips and other afterschool activities!

Successful driver applicants will be trained to perform all driver duties to obtain a Commercial Drivers License (CDL).We provide paid Commercial Drivers License (CDL) training and guide you through the school bus driver CDL certification process.

CONDITIONS OF EMPLOYMENT

  1. Minimum age of 21 with at least 5 years driving experience.
  2. Successful completion of training or certification programs related to position. This could include but is not limited to one of the following: High School Diploma GED AA BA etc. if applicable.
  3. Must be able to perform the essential functions of the position with or without reasonable accommodation.
  4. Must meet the Physical Demands of the position.
  5. Successful completion of Bus Driver training program.
  6. Must possess or be willing to obtaina CDL Class B passenger endorsement school bus endorsement and air brake restriction removed.
  7. Must pass a basic skills test.
  8. Must be First Aid certified or be willing to obtain First Aid certification with thirty 30 days of employment.
  9. Completion of Safe Schools Web Based Training within thirty 30 days of hire and yearly thereafter.
  10. Must pass a background check which includes employee paid fingerprinting.

REQUIREMENTS OF POSITION

  1. Minimum of two 2 supervisory references indicating satisfactory skills and abilities.
  2. Must uphold board policies and follow administrative procedures.
  3. Must take all necessary and reasonable precautions to protect students equipment materials and facilities.
  4. Must maintain the physical and licensing requirements of a CDL bus driver as required.
  5. Must be able to pass a yearly bus evacuation drill and maintain the physical requirements of removing children safely from the bus. Must possess sufficient strength and ability to assist ill or physically impaired students to enter or exit a school bus through the passenger service door.
  6. Must attend yearly inservice trainings as required as well as attend any training as directed by management.
  7. Evidence of ability to assess and correct issues involving safety.
  8. Evidence of ability to establish and maintain a tactful cooperative and effective relationship with students parents staff fellow employees and management.
  9. Evidence of ability to approach assigned work in a professional manner working toward the common goal of teamwork pride in service delivery and continuous improvement
  10. Must demonstrate sufficient command of the English language to communicate verbally and in writing with students parents district staff members and other concerned people regarding all aspects of their jobrelated activities.
  11. Must be able to use basic computer programs to develop route sheets enter timecard information and read and respond to email.

QUALIFICATIONS PREFERRED

  1. Previous experience working with young people preferred.
  2. Evidence of ability to manage large groups of young people.
  3. Evidence of excellent attendance punctuality and dependability; evidence of ability to be selfdisciplined and a selfstarter.
  4. Positive job evaluations and recommendations.

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S AND JOB RESPONSIBILITIES

The bus driver will:

  1. Efficiently operate a school bus on scheduled routes and/or on all types of trips in support of district approved activities both within and outside the school district boundaries.
  2. Maintain and update route sheets in a timely manner.
  3. Operate school buses under all types of weather conditions including but not limited to fog rain hail sleet snow and ice.
  4. Communicate route changes and requirements to dispatch and management in a timely manner.
  5. Service inspect and clean school buses and related equipment as required by State and district policy.
  6. Maintain control of student passengers as related to safety; report unsafe acts or conditions which required the attention of any person other than the driver.
  7. Complete forms records and reports as required by the State or local school district policies.
  8. Successfully complete school bus driver training programs and courses established by the State Superintendent of Public Instruction and the school district.
  9. Operate a school bus in accordance with the laws of the State of Washington and policies declared by the Superintendent of Public Instruction.
  10. Perform all duties of the position within the scope of Kennewick School District policies and procedures including regular attendance and punctuality
  11. Perform other school bus driver related duties as directed by local school district policies.
  12. Accomplish all tasks in a professional manner. Model appropriate and healthy adult behavior. Interact with people and speak in a manner that reflects community standards of politeness civility and human sensitivity.

JOB RELATED TASKS

The bus driver will:

  1. Operate and service all school bus equipment and accessories including but not limited to fire extinguishers highway warning kits snow chains first aid kits etc.
  2. Perform required operational and safety inspections of the school bus and all related equipment.
  3. Clean and service the school bus to include interior/exterior sweeping and washing maintaining appropriate of fuel oil and coolant tire inflation levels etc.
  4. Operate all hand and foot controls installed in a school bus as required by Washington State (minimum) school bus specification.
  5. Perform basic first aid as appropriate which may include CPR.
  6. Complete clerical tasks as assigned both in writing and on computer; legible and accurate completion of forms records time sheets trip requests route studies trouble reports misconduct reports accident reports and other clerical activities as may be required.
  7. Perform other jobrelated duties as assigned by supervisor.
